Emergency Preparedness and Response Coordinator – Lincoln County Health & Human Services
Lincoln County Health & Human Services is looking for an Emergency Preparedness and Response Coordinator to join the team to help make our community safer and better prepared for unexpected events. This person will plan, organize, and administer Public Health (PH) and Health and Human Services (HHS) Emergency Preparedness activities, including pre-emergency planning, emergency response activities, and post-emergency functions. This role is also responsible for collaborating with local, regional, and state partners to strengthen Lincoln County’s HHS emergency preparedness and response infrastructure.

Planning:
- Develop, integrate, and maintain PH and HHS emergency response plans, manuals, and standard operating procedures by utilizing local, state, and federal regulatory guidelines and requirements.
- Meet PH Reaccreditation and modernization planning requirements and efforts.
- Maintain the HHS Emergency Management Overview policy.
- Ensure functional, cultural, linguistic, and accessibility needs are met within emergency planning efforts.
- Conduct research and analysis related to public health emergency response preparedness.
- Conduct a risk assessment relevant to HHS and PH every two years.
- Participate in updates and revisions to relevant county Emergency Management (EM) plans.
- Assist with the development of mutual aid-/collaborative agreements with regional/contiguous county health departments, first responder, governmental, and non-governmental agencies.
Training and Exercises:
- Develop and implement a multi-year preparedness training plan related to emergency preparedness, response, and recovery for relevant staff positions in HHS.
- Plan and conduct required drills and exercises annually with staff and other government and community agencies involved in PH emergency preparedness and response.
- Conduct after action reviews following drills and exercises, and coordinate implementation of reviews’ recommendations.
- Participate in drills and exercises coordinated by Lincoln County Emergency Management (LCEM) and partner organizations as appropriate.
Budget and workplan administration:
- Develop annual work plan and amendments, in collaboration with PH Modernization Manager and other department divisions.
- Track and document workplan deliverables throughout the year to ensure all requirements are met.
- Utilize confidential information to develop annual budget and review budget vs actuals in collaboration with the Modernization Manager.
- Conduct the annual Capability Assessment in collaboration with the PH leadership team.
- Prepare and submit required reports including those for grant compliance.
- Conduct work in alignment with Oregon Health Authority Triennial Review requirements and participate in review meetings as required.
Communications and Public
Education:
- Coordinate with PH Public Information Officer (PIO) to develop and distribute emergency messaging and routine awareness and education communications.
- Maintain and regularly update PH emergency contact lists and notification systems.
- Develop and deliver PH emergency preparedness education and outreach to community members, community organizations, and partner agencies, with attention to culturally competent and accessible communications across diverse populations.
- Coordinate notifications to PH staff during emergency activation and exercises and run regular tests of the staff emergency notification system.
